THE SPORTS & GROUNDS EXPO TO DOUBLE IN SIZE THIS JULY

The UK ’ s premier outdoor sports and grounds maintenance tradeshow , SAGE is taking place on 6th & 7th July at The Three Counties Showground in Malvern . Focus on sustainability This year , sustainability has become an even more prominent priority across all industries and SAGE is proud to be hosting the first sustainability summit , which will take place on Wednesday 6th July at SAGE 2022 , in partnership with Bio-Circle . The summit will be led by experts across the industry , and will provide guidance and support on how sustainable solutions can be achieved by businesses across the sports and grounds maintenance industry . The panel along with their colleagues will be on hand to deliver tailored options for those looking to adopt processes that are more environmentally friendly .
With the Government ’ s carbon net zero targets to comply with , more businesses have started to explore the different ways that they can reduce carbon emissions . The summit will target this topic head on and help to drive a better understanding of the priorities and solutions for the sports and grounds maintenance industry regarding their responsibilities for reducing carbon emissions .
Now the ‘ Home Event ’ for GRASS SAGE are proud to announce that they have become the home event for GRASS , a newly launched forum built by a Group of Groundcare Industry Specialists . GRASS stands for , Groundcare Resources & Sustainability Suppliers , and is the innovative idea of Mark Tomlinson head of environmental and sustainability stadia projects at Bio- Circle , one of the leading companies paving the way in sustainable solutions for the industry .
The NEW Networking & Support Forum is a FREE to join group that supports all Groundcare and other sporting industry sustainability projects , providing free advice and knowledge of sustainable pitch care .
